Register for a One-of-a-Kind Kando Trip

Sony has announced that they are opening up their flagship “Kando Trip” photography experience to public applications. This year’s event will take place in Monterrey, CA from May 9-12 and offers attendees a choice of over 20 interactive classes and workshops.

Loosely translated from Japanese, Kando means, “Being in the moment, present with expressive technology.” Most recently Kando was discussed at CES and the term further refined to mean

Bringing out emotions in people

To make people say, “wow.” Taking a look at the Kando 2.0 schedule and speakers, there’s much wow in what I expect to be a great experience hanging out with Sony, their fans, and professionals.

Kando 2.0 will take place May 9-12 at the oceanfront Asilomar Conference Grounds in Monterrey, CA.  The four day, three night, all-inclusive experience will offer attendees a choice of over 20 interactive classes and workshops covering many different genres of photography, video storytelling, business and social media best practices, software and hardware tutorials from partner sponsors and more.

Additionally, there will be shooting sessions at several iconic locations along the Monterey/Big Sur coastline, keynote speakers, product feedback sessions, contests, giveaways and many other fun activities.  Throughout the event, attendees will have access to loaners and trials of all of Sony’s most popular cameras, lenses and accessories.

Commenting about Kando Trip 2.0, Neal Manowitz, Vice President of Digital Imaging at Sony Electronics, said,  “We are continually striving to deliver ‘Kando’ with everything that we do – every product, service, activity, and campaign.  Kando Trip is the ultimate representation of this concept.  It’s  an event exclusively designed for our community – a chance to for us all to interact, learn and grow together, with ‘wow’ experiences waiting around every corner.”

If you’re into Sony cameras or want to be, this is the event of the year. During Kando Trip 2.0, attendees can meet, share ideas and give feedback to Sony’s engineering, product planning, marketing, and business teams.
